A tranquil rural setting just 40 minutes from Wondai and 50 minutes from Kingaroy, this generous 51.76-acre (20.95-hectare) property presents a fantastic opportunity for those seeking space, privacy, and potential. With a blend of semi-cleared bushland and open areas, the block is ideal for running cattle or establishing your dream rural retreat. The natural regrowth can be managed effectively with livestock, allowing the landscape to open up further with time.
Water is well accounted for, with two good-sized dams (1 spring feed) providing supply, and a seasonal creek meandering towards the rear of the property adds both charm and utility. The block is fenced on three sides, with the rear, front and one side fully secure, while the middle boundary remains open to the adjoining property, which is also owned by the current vendor.
Two rustic shed structures sit on the land - one is fully enclosed, offering protection for tools and equipment, while the second, with an open front, offers additional storage or shelter options. and a third was an old original toilet shed for the previous owners an older Nuffield BMC tractor is included in the sale. Though it has not been operated in some time and will require new tyres and a service, it could be restored for use around the block. There are also currently to car bodies that were at the property when purchased last time by the now current owners and again will remain at the property when sold.
The size of Coverty is approximately 88.4 square kilometres. The population of Coverty in 2016 was 167 people. By 2021 the population was 107 showing a population decline of 35.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coverty is 50-59 years. Households in Coverty are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ying under $300 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coverty work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 87.80% of the homes in Coverty were owner-occupied compared with 72.40% in 2016.
